More than €2m stolen in Dublin security van raid

A gang of armed raiders has escaped with more than €2m after holding up a security van in Dublin this morning.

A lone raider approached the security van at a service station on Skelly's Lane in Artane at around 7.30am.

He then threatened the driver with a handgun before ordering him to drive to the sports grounds in nearby Killester, where they were met by a number of others raiders.

Gardaí said the gang stole between €2m and €2.5m from the security van.
